Error code 2 on your August Smart Lock means the door sensor isn't detecting the magnet, which prevents the lock from knowing whether the door is open or closed. This typically requires recalibrating the sensor and ensuring proper alignment between the sensor and magnet.

How to Fix Error Code 2

  1. Check door sensor and magnet alignment

    Make sure the lock is in a powered state before proceeding. Do not use excessive force to move components.
  2. Perform calibration from the August app

  3. Remove obstructions near the sensor

  4. Check battery level

    Use only recommended battery types to avoid damage.
  5. Re-install the sensor and magnet

    If the sensor or magnet appears damaged, replace them before proceeding.
  6. Factory reset the lock

    Factory reset will delete all settings. You will need to reconnect to Wi-Fi and reconfigure access codes.

When to Call a Professional

If after factory reset and proper alignment the error persists, the door sensor or magnet may be defective. Contact August support or a professional smart lock installer for replacement.

Frequently Asked Questions

What does error code 2 mean on August Smart Lock?
Error code 2 indicates the door sensor cannot detect the magnet, meaning the lock doesn't know if the door is open or closed. This often requires recalibration or realignment.
How do I recalibrate my August Smart Lock?
Open the August app, select your lock, go to settings, and choose 'Calibrate'. Follow the instructions to open and close the door when prompted.
Can low batteries cause error code 2?
Yes, low batteries can affect sensor communication. Replace batteries if below 20% and recalibrate.
Where is the magnet on August Smart Lock?
The magnet is installed on the door frame, aligning with the sensor on the lock when the door is closed.
Do I need to remove the lock to fix error code 2?
No, you usually don't need to remove the lock. Adjust the magnet position or recalibrate via the app. Only remove if checking internal wiring.
